Synthesis and characterization of polycholesteryl methacrylate–polyhydroxyethyl methyacrylate block copolymers

Journal of Polymer Science Part A, 2008
AbstractWe report the synthesis and characterization of a series of novel diblock copolymers, poly(cholesteryl methacrylate‐b‐2‐hydroxyethyl methacrylate) (PCMA‐b‐PHEMA). Monomers, cholesteryl methacrylate (CMA) and 2‐(trimethylsiloxy)ethyl methacrylate (HEMA‐TMS), were prepared from methyacryloyl chloride and 2‐hydroxyethyl methacrylate, respectively.

Chondroitin sulfate–coated polyhydroxyethyl methacrylate membrane prevents adhesion in full-thickness tendon tears of rabbits

Journal of Hand Surgery, 2002
Polyhydroxyethyl methacrylate (pHEMA) membranes coated on one side with chondroitin sulfate (CS) were used to block adhesion physically and to reduce friction between healing flexor tendons and the surrounding tissue in rabbit forepaws after surgical repair.
